Output 7e85d488f705e3028016dfd1f0e3a55d6c8a4036033ed3648d4496dc54a8b13d:1

value
21073
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95b6851582357bae1eea3373c70a35a4aca28902fa441a4eecfbd407126db525
address
bc1pjkmg29vzx4a6u8h2xdeuwz345jk29zgzlfzp5nhvl02qwyndk5jsxwdart
transaction
7e85d488f705e3028016dfd1f0e3a55d6c8a4036033ed3648d4496dc54a8b13d
confirmations
4882
spent
true